1. Ifihan
Awọn AMP Research PowerStep is an automatic, electric-powered running board system designed to provide convenient and safe vehicle access. These steps extend instantly when the vehicle door is opened and retract out of sight when the door closes, maintaining ground clearance and vehicle aesthetics. Constructed from die-cast aluminum alloy with stainless steel pivot pins, the PowerStep offers robust stability and all-weather performance.

5. Awọn ilana Iṣiṣẹ
- Automatic Deployment: The PowerSteps will automatically deploy when any vehicle door is opened.
- Idapada Aifọwọyi: The PowerSteps will automatically retract approximately 3 seconds after all vehicle doors are closed.
- Manual Override (for cleaning/roof access): To keep the steps deployed for cleaning or accessing the vehicle roof, apply slight pressure to the step with your foot while closing the door. The step will remain extended until the door is opened again without pressure, or until the vehicle is driven.

6. Itọju
- Ninu igbagbogbo: Keep the step surfaces clean from dirt, mud, and debris. The steps can be sprayed down and washed while deployed.
- Pivot Pin Inspection: Periodically inspect the stainless steel pivot pins for any signs of wear or corrosion. These pins are designed to be rust-proof for long-lasting operation.
- Lubrication: Apply a silicone-based lubricant to the pivot points annually or as needed to ensure smooth operation.
